Many dog owners experience a problem with aggression. If not addressed, aggression can cause severe injuries to pets and humans. In severe cases the bite of a dog could cause the animal to be returned to a shelter or even to the animal control department to be killed. There is good news that aggression can be treated. Fear and anxiety are frequently the root of aggression but it can also be due to genetics or a negative experience.
A good trainer will address these concerns and work with you to help your dog overcome his fears and anxieties. If you are looking for a dog trainer near you, look for certifications and references, and ask about their training techniques. While anyone can make business cards, it’s important to find a certified trainer who follows the ethics guidelines of their certifying body and doesn’t use any abrasive methods of training.
You must also seek out a trainer with experience in dealing with dogs who are aggressive. They will have experience dealing with dogs that have aggressive behaviors and provide you with insights into your dog’s thinking. They will be able to provide you with some suggestions on whether your dog needs medication or could benefit from seeing a veterinary behavior specialist (DACVB). DACVBs are vets that specialize in animal behavior, and a lot of people who have aggressive dogs later regret not having seen one sooner because they can see the vast improvements these experts can make to their dog’s behaviour.

Certain trainers are reliant on methods of training based on dominance that be used to issue “corrections” such as putting your dog back in the alpha roll, or grabbing the collar of their dog to stop them from barking or biting and using electronic static or vibrating collars. These methods can initially make your dog more obedient however they can also cause anxiety and fear, which can lead to an increase in aggression.
The best online dog training will focus on helping you develop an improved relationship with your pet, so that they respect you even when they are anxious, scared or anxious. It is essential to practice this with pets with aggressive behaviour because they are more likely to respond violently to triggers.
Many owners find that their dog’s aggressive behavior is anxious or feel that they have to protect their home or family, that can be dealt with by a professional trainer. A group obedience class or a one-on-one session with a trainer who’s skilled can assist your dog improve his confidence.
